The Charm of Tea Tin Cans A Journey Through Tradition and Design


In recent years, the world has seen a significant revival of interest in traditional practices, and tea drinking stands as one of the most cherished. Central to this experience is the seemingly humble tea tin can, a container that not only preserves the freshness of tea but also reflects cultural significance, artistic expression, and sustainability.


A Snapshot of History


The use of tin cans for tea dates back centuries, particularly in regions like China and Britain, where tea has been celebrated both as a beverage and an art form. Historically, tea was fragile and expensive, requiring sturdy packaging to guard against moisture, pests, and contamination. Early tea tins often featured intricate designs, proudly displaying the origins of the tea and its unique qualities. For many consumers, these cans were not mere containers but symbols of an elegant lifestyle.


Practicality Meets Aesthetics


One of the primary benefits of tea tin cans is their ability to preserve the delicate flavors and aromas of tea leaves. Unlike paper or plastic packaging, tin canisters provide an airtight seal, protecting the tea from light, air, and humidity. This is especially crucial for loose-leaf teas, which can lose their essential characteristics if not stored properly. The metal’s durability also means that these cans can be reused for years, making them a practical choice for avid tea drinkers.


Yet, it’s not just practicality that makes tea tins appealing. Many manufacturers have embraced the world of design, creating visually stunning packages that catch the eye. Artisans skillfully paint traditional motifs, botanical illustrations, or modern geometric patterns on these cans, turning them into collectible pieces. The aesthetic allure of a beautifully designed tea tin can enhance the overall tea experience, transforming a simple ritual into an artful occasion.

Sustainability and Eco-Friendliness


As global awareness grows regarding environmental issues, the tea tin can also stands out for its sustainability. Unlike single-use plastic packaging, metal tins are recyclable and often made from materials that are less harmful to the environment. In fact, many companies today prioritize sustainable sourcing and eco-friendly practices, responding to consumers who are increasingly looking to reduce their ecological footprint. By choosing tea in tin cans, not only are we opting for a product that preserves flavor, but we’re also making a conscious decision to support practices that are better for our planet.


A Personal Touch


For many, the act of preparing and enjoying tea is a ritual that stretches beyond mere consumption. The ritual often includes selecting a tea tin that resonates with personal aesthetics or nostalgia, creating a sense of connection to cultural heritage. Some people even use empty tea cans for DIY crafts, turning them into planters, organizers, or decorative pieces for their homes, thus extending the life of the container well beyond its original purpose.
